Method for compensating a low-frequency disturbance force of a rotor by means of active magnetic bearings, active magnetic bearing having a compensation control circuit for performing the compensation, and use of the magnetic bearing
Abstract:
A method for compensating at least one low-frequency mechanical disturbance oscillation, which is caused in a rotor of an active magnetic bearing by the action of a disturbance force on the rotor is provided. The mechanical disturbance oscillation has a disturbance oscillation frequency below a rotational frequency of the rotor. The method includes the following steps: a) analyzing the low-frequency mechanical disturbance oscillation, b) determining a compensation force for producing in the rotor a mechanical compensation force that counteracts the mechanical disturbance oscillation, and c) applying the compensation force to the rotor, wherein steps a), b), and c) are performed by means of at least one compensation control circuit of the active magnetic bearing that is decoupled from a magnetic-bearing control circuit for controlling the active magnetic bearing. The invention further relates to a corresponding active magnetic bearing.
